On 25 July 2019 McAuley House participated in Athletics day held at Knox Park Athletics Track where each House competed against the others in order to win the House cup. The day gave the students the chance to win House points by participating in several events such as discus, shot-put, high jump, long jump, and track events such as the 50 metre and 100 metre sprint, as well as plenty more. The Year 12 students were allowed to dress up as certain characters to represent their House colours as it was their final Athletics day.
The students made memories and overall had fun. There was a good atmosphere and McAuley had some excellent competitors making the day very exciting. McAuley House finished in 3rd place on the day, doing pretty well, and overall the day was quite eventful.

Year 7 and 8 v Timbarra College
On Friday 26 July, the Year 7 and 8 Basketballers played their first ever game against Timbarra College. The girls got things under way and came up against a quality team that had a number of rep players who proved the difference. Our girls learned a great deal from this regarding the fitness required to play a game at this intensity and what they need to be working on to further improve.
The boys were involved in a much closer game and although they lost by 20 points we had some great performances by Andrya Oshla and Malcolm Kilfoyle.
The students and their coach will continue to work on elements of the game in preparation for the Junior SIS Basketball Competition in Term 4.

AeroSchool Aerobics Competition
On Friday the 2nd of August, 12 students from the Nazareth Aerobics team competed in their very first AeroSchools State Competition held at Community Bank Stadium in Diamond Creek. Four teams competed and all of the students looked and performed exceptionally well. Congratulations to the following students who competed: Ourania Adamopoulos, Isabella Vormwald, Chloe Boric, Anaisha Sharma, Mackenzie Easton, Nyudong Landid, Corrine Lakat, Sophie Xerri, Damon Weibgen, Lia Stana, Emma Sidea and Jenna Andrikopoulos.
A further congratulations to the Year 8 duo team and Year 7 trio team who qualified to compete in the National AeroSchools Championships. They will compete to represent Victoria on the Gold Coast next month.

Year 8 HPE Sports Education
Year 8 Health and Physical Education students have participated in a Sport Education Program which provided an opportunity for students to participate in many alternative and challenging sessions, including Self Defence, Fencing, Handball, Lacrosse, Combat Fitness and Ultimate Frisbee.
Learning that takes place in, through and about physical activity in HPE also benefits the student by promoting and supporting lifelong dispositions of physically active living.
